Output c83a6b307ebf84ebf824a4e3e16b5073f20c17d9d286fd442474bef49ec507ff:34

value
8983665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436c865cc535012bf5b3e19e3b8dad6b09cb1847 OP_EQUAL
address
ME3fWipRPxFzWDd3RcUP2DoifqAR5rzW9P
transaction
c83a6b307ebf84ebf824a4e3e16b5073f20c17d9d286fd442474bef49ec507ff
spent
true